Self reversing screw(also known as a level winder screws,reverse spooling screws or diamond screws.)is a precision component that converts rotary motion into linear motion.Its structure primarily consists of three parts: the self reversing screw shaft,the PAWL(reversing key),and the block nut.These three components work in synergy,determining the precision and service life of the entire transmission system.Under special operating conditions—such as underwater applications and no lubrication—the material selection for these three parts becomes a complex interplay of physics,chemistry,and mechanical engineering.

Key Engineering Challenges
Designing a self-reversing screw(screw shaft,nut,and reversing pawl)for fully submerged and oil-free freshwater applications requires addressing three core issues:
Corrosion Resistance: The material must withstand long-term immersion in fresh water without rusting or pitting.
Galling Prevention:Identical materials sliding together—especially austenitic stainless steels—are highly prone to cold welding and seizure under pressure,particularly without lubrication.
Wear Management:To maximize service life,the system should allow the easily replaceable nut to wear sacrificially,protecting the costly screw shaft.
Recommended Material Combination
Screw Shaft: Stainless Steel (SS304/SS316/SS316L)
Provides sufficient corrosion resistance for freshwater.
SS316L offers improved resistance to intergranular corrosion due to lower carbon content.
Acts as the protected core component.
Nut: Bronze Alloy
Creates a dissimilar metal couple with the steel shaft,fundamentally eliminating galling risk.
Softer than stainless steel,it functions as the sacrificial part,wearing preferentially to extend screw shaft life.
Inherent self-lubricating properties ensure smooth operation in oil-free conditions.
Reversing Pawl: 2507 Duplex Stainless Steel
The pawl experiences continuous shear and impact during reversal;duplex steel offers nearly double the yield strength of 316L.
High hardness and exceptional resistance to pitting/crevice corrosion ensure long-term reliability in water.
